Lane Johnson to miss Eagles matchup vs. Buccaneers with a concussion
The Eagles will be without All-Pro right tackle Lane Johnson after he could not clear the concussion protocol. Johnson exited Philadelphia’s 15-12 win over New Orleans with a head injury and didn’t return to the game. Johnson was present at this week’s final two days of practice, and made the trip to Tampa.
